DEFINITIONS UNDER PWD : i)Orthopedically Challenged (OC) -A person having a minimum of 40% physical defect or deformity which causes interference with the normal functioning of the bones, muscles and joints and is so certified by a Medical Board appointed by the State Government. ii)Visually Challenged (VC) Blindness refers to a person who suffers from either of the following conditions:(a)Total absence of sight.(b)Visual acuity not exceeding 6/60 or 20/200 (Snellen) in the better eye with correcting lenses, Limitation of the field of vision subtending an angle of 20 degree or worse and so certified by a Medical Board appointed by the State Government.(c)A person with Low Vision means one with impairment of visual functioning even after treatment of standard refractive correction but who uses or is potentially capable of using vision for the planning or execution of a task with appropriate assisting device. iii)Deaf & Hearing Impaired (HI) : (a)Deaf are those persons in whom the sense of hearing is non-functional for ordinary purposes of life, i.e. with total loss of hearing in both ears. They do not hear and understand sounds at all - even with amplified speech.(b)Hearing Impairment means loss of more than 60 decibels in the better ear in the conversational range of frequencies Locomotors Disability or Cerebral Palsy - Person who has a minimum of 40% of physical defect or deformity which causes an interference with the normal functioning of the bones, muscles and joints. Use of a Scribe / Paper Writer (Available for Post Code 003 - Law Officer): A SCRIBE, to write the written test / examination, on behalf of a Visually Challenged (VC) candidate [Blind] and Orthopedically Challenged (OC) candidate [whose writing speed is affected by Cerebral Palsy], may be used. In all such cases where a Scribe is used, the following rules will apply: *The candidate will have to arrange his own Scribe at his own cost. *The Scribe should be from an academic stream other than that of the candidate. *The academic qualification of the Scribe should be one grade lower than the stipulated minimum eligibility criteria and the Scribe should possess less marks than the candidate and in no case more than 60% marks. Both the candidate as well as the Scribe will have to give a suitable undertaking confirming that the Scribe fulfils all the stipulated eligibility criteria as mentioned above. In case it later transpires that the scribe did not fulfill any of the laid down eligibility criteria or had suppressed material facts, the candidature of the applicant will stand cancelled, irrespective of the result of the written examination.Candidates who use a Scribe will be eligible for extra time @ 20 minutes for every hour of the examination.
